Physical Education Syllabus

Physical Education is a participation class. This means that without an excuse from a doctor or a note from a parent, a student is expected to dress out and participate every day. Parent notes are only good for (3) days. If a student is unable to participate for longer than 3 days, a doctor’s excuse must be presented to the teacher. The doctor‘s excuse should state the nature of the illness or injury and what activities the student can or can’t do.

Procedures:

  • Students must respect others and their property
  • NO CELL PHONE USE IN THE GYM DURING THE SCHOOL DAY. Cell phones must remain locked up in the locked up in the locker room during class.
  • Follow directions the first time they are given.
  • Dressing out is defined as wearing different clothes than the ones worn to school. Clothing suitable for dressing out is athletic shoes, t-shirt, shorts (acceptable in length), or sweats. Shorts must be worn over yoga pants and spandex.
  • Consequences for not dressing out:

1st offense- Verbal Warning

2nd offense- Physical Education Modification

3rd offense- Notification to Parents (e-mail or phone)

4th offense- AAA Detention

5th offense- Office referral ISSP

  • Locker room doors will be locked (3) minutes after the last student enters the locker room.
  • Lock up all valuables (clothes, purses, and jewelry). This is the student’s responsibility!
  • No gum, candy, or food in the locker room, gym, or athletic field.
  • No running or horseplay in the locker room or gym.
  • Do not touch any equipment unless given permission.

Grading Policies

A student’s grade will be lowered for failure to dress out or failure to participate in assigned activities. Students may be given written and skills test. Please remember that grades are not given they are earned.
